Organic Chemistry of Sulfur

24-29 July 2016, Jena, Germany

From the journal Chemistry International

The 27th International Symposium on Organic Chemistry of Sulfur, with the specific theme of from fundamental research to application, will take place in Jena, Germany, from 24-29 July 2016.

The Conference Chair, Professor Wolfgang Weigand, is organizing a rich program, including the following topics: Advanced materials, Agricultural chemistry, Bio-organic, bioorganometallic (coordination chemistry), Environmental issues, Catalysis, Medicinal chemistry, Sulfur-polymer composite materials, Nanotechnology, Organic Chemistry of Sulfur, Primordial chemistry, Stereoselective synthesis.

The conference will take place at the Friedrich-Schiller-University Jena, surrounded by the picturesque vineyards and shell limestone mountains of the Saale-Valley. Only a few years after the political revolution in the Eastern part of Germany took place, Jena emerged as a city of economic, scientific, cultural, and social prestige. It is the home of world-renowned institutions, including two Leibniz Institutes and three Max-Planck-Institutes, and looks back on an impressive history in the field of optical works and research strongly associated with names such as Carl Zeiss and Ernst Abbe. Nearly 25,000 students contribute to Jena‘s image as Thuringia‘s intellectual center, which is mainly based on philosophers of international prominence like Schiller, Goethe and Hegel.
